Nooks & Crannies
The first touch of morning sun floats across cool dew
Traversing through the deep green shade of an old tree
Making a radiant entrance across softly billowing bedroom curtains
Landing upon my exposed foot which has escaped the silky sheet
* * *
The gossamer golden light is nearly imperceptible in my sleeping state
Perhaps even providing a tale about which to dream - of sweet warmth
Yet, as it always does, the affect upon my repose is to gently wake
Slowly carrying me from the slumberwagon to the reality of a new day
* * *
With eyes still shut, but ears now open to the chorus of gleeful birdsong
My leg slides across the cool sheets, my cheek perceives the pillow
I feel the gentle breeze flow over me, brushing me with freshness
My first thoughts of consciousness arrive, and I think of only You
* * *
Lying still, wanting but to inhale the last tender feelings of a dream
I recognize then my reality, the new day, the warmth falling upon my foot
I open my eyes, examining my world of streaming sunlight
Which breaks through the last few moments of pre-dawn, and You are there
* * *
Between each nook and cranny of my awakening exists the thought of You
A dog, completing his evening’s sleep, yawns and blinks, and I think of You
The cat meowing for his breakfast a world away, but only down the stairs
Brings thoughts of sharing orange juice and blueberry muffins with only You
* * *
My day will be like this, as each day always is, as each day always will be
The drab routine of moving along a typical avenue, which is lit by the essence of You
Contemplating simple thoughts, resolving uncomplicated riddles, Thinking of You
Between each nook and cranny of my simple life lies the certainty of Love and You.
